Output 45628662560e62c3a6074d1108722b6fff128298a83e97319d4f9dc344074521:0

value
86813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223bed7dd2cd1015ffa7ad080467cd3d4b598a9f OP_EQUAL
address
34p2gv4YKXhPgmjUYj6GAaWUtnbEbCJmbK
transaction
45628662560e62c3a6074d1108722b6fff128298a83e97319d4f9dc344074521
spent
true